With the weather getting colder, I have noticed that my Columbus does not like reading from the SD card until (let's say) it has "warmed up".

If I eject and reinsert, I either get no response, or the SD card error message. After about 10 mins though, it accepts the card.

I haven't had any problems at all over the summer, and the card seems fine (its a 32Gb Class 10 "7DayShop.com" special.)

Anyone had similar experiences?
